#24150e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24150e is composed of 14.1% red, 8.2%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 85.9% black. It has a hue angle of 19.1 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 9.8%. #24150e color hex could be obtained by blending #482a1c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

● #24150e color description : Very dark (mostly black) orange [Brown tone].
#24150e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#24150e has RGB values of R:36, G:21,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.61,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 2364686.
